Melatonin is a hormone normally produced in the pineal gland and released into the blood. The essential amino acid L-tryptophan is a precursor in the synthesis of melatonin. It helps regulate sleep-wake cycles or the circadian rhythm. Melatonin is a hormone produced by the pineal gland in the brain. Its level varies throughout the day and night to control your body clock. Melatonin levels are higher at night and are lower in bright daylight. Your body naturally increases melatonin levels about 2 hours before going to sleep, to get you ready for sleep. The bottom line. Lisinopril (Zestril) is an ang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itor that's commonly prescribed to treat high blood pressure. People taking it may experience common side effects like dizziness, headache, or a dry cough. Less common lisinopril side effects include diarrhea, blurred vision, and temporary erectile dysfunction.

It has a half-life of 20 to 45 minutes. How long melatonin lasts depends on the type of supplement you take, your age, and whether you smoke, consume caffeine, or take medication. Fast-release melatonin supplements can last less time than extended-release melatonin.How Much Melatonin Is Too Much? The most common dosage range of melatonin is between 1 mg and 5 mg, but the recommended dose for children is typically a lot lower- under 3 mg.
